What is a blkittiwake?
A Black-legged Kittiwake (Rissa tridactyla) is a small (17") gull that spends much of its life at sea.  It's one of my favorite bird.  I've seen them nesting at Bempton Cliffs in England, and I'm always thrilled when I see them off the California coast.
